En Route 57 is an 18-hole championship course at Nkonyeni Golf Lodge & Estate in the Manzini region of Eswatini, formerly known as Swaziland. Designed by South African architect Phil Jacobs, the course occupies rolling terrain in the country's interior lowveld, where the landscape transitions between highveld grasslands and subtropical vegetation. The estate setting provides views across the surrounding valleys and distant mountain ranges that characterize this part of southern Africa.
Jacobs, known for his work on courses throughout southern Africa, routed the layout to incorporate the natural contours and existing drainage patterns of the property. The design reflects regional golf architecture traditions common to courses in Eswatini and neighboring South Africa, with fairways that follow the land's movement and greens positioned to take advantage of elevation changes. Water features and indigenous vegetation come into play on several holes, typical of lowveld courses in this climate zone.
The course serves as the centerpiece of a residential and hospitality development, with the lodge providing accommodation for visiting golfers. Nkonyeni functions as one of the limited number of regulation golf facilities in Eswatini, a small landlocked nation where golf infrastructure remains modest compared to its larger neighbors. The course attracts both local members and international visitors traveling through the region, particularly those exploring southern African golf destinations beyond the more established South African circuits.
